57 Abstract AB [EN] P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a photoelectric sensor for detecting an object within a three-dimensional monitoring area having a plurality of scanning areas.SOLUTION: The photoelectric sensor comprises: a light-emitting unit for emitting an emission beam, the unit including a light emitter for generating the emission beam and a beam divider for dividing the emission beam into a plurality of partial emission beams spatially separated from each other; a light-receiving unit having a spatial resolution provided with a plurality of light-receiving areas to generate a received-light signal from the emission beam diffusion reflected or directly reflected from a monitoring area, each of the light-receiving areas being disposed for one scanning area so that only the emission beam diffusion reflected or directly reflected within a scanning area is received by the light-receiving area; a scanning device capable of rotating around the axis of rotation, the scanning device periodically changing the radiation direction of the emission light and changing the light-receiving direction of the light-receiving unit synchronously therewith; and an evaluation unit for detecting an object on the basis of the received-light signal.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1
